摘要
PROBLEM TO BE SOLVED: To eliminate the need for placing a rod-shaped insulator upright using a crane and to enable a bending load test to be conducted efficiently by holding on a support stand a flanged part at one end of the rod-shaped insulator lying on its side, and applying a load perpendicular to the longitudinal direction of the rod-shaped insulator to a flanged part at the other end. ;SOLUTION: A rod-shaped insulator 20 is mounted on a sample base 6 placed at the center of a base 1, and a flanged metal fitting 25 at the lower part of the insulator 20 is held by a support stand 9. A flanged metal fitting 24 at the upper part (top) of the insulator 20 is placed on the lower jacking punch 3 of a hydraulic jack 2, and the punch 3 is raised to apply a predetermined load to the insulator 20. Next, the insulator 20 is rotated about its longitudinal axis by 90 degrees for each rotation, and a bending load test is conducted by applying the predetermined load to the insulator 20 from four directions. This method can greatly reduce the number of operations and enables the bending load test to be conducted easily at the installation site of the insulator 20, resulting in enhanced convenience and greatly reduced facility cost.;COPYRIGHT: (C)1997,JPO
